Welcome to Per Rudquist, our new GreEnergy Project Coordinator

We are happy to welcome Ass. Prof. Per Rudquist who has just joined GreEnergy as project coordinator!

Per Rudquist is at the department of Microtechnology and Nanoscience at Chalmers University of Technology. His research interests include physics and device physics of chiral liquid crystals, with focus on optics, electrooptic effects, and applications. He is also co-founder of the company Orthocone Innovation Technologies AB (Gothenburg, Sweden), developing orthoconic antiferroelectric liquid crystals and applications.

In GreEnergy, Per will be the intermediary between the consortium and the European Commission and will be responsible for EC reporting and the scientific coordination, ensuring productive collaboration between the consortium partners and successful progress of the project!

Per succeeds Dr. Yifeng Fu who has just left Chalmers University of Technology to join the Novo Energy company (Gothenburg, Sweden), after coordinating GreEnergy for one year.
